Boosting Your Pumpkin Patch with AI Algorithms
Farmers are constantly striving new ways to improve their yields. With the rise of artificial intelligence (AI), a treasure of possibilities now exist to revolutionize agriculture, and pumpkin patches are no exception. AI algorithms can be employed to examine vast amounts of insights, uncovering patterns and patterns that can help farmers harvest healthier, more productive pumpkins.
- AI-powered technologies can monitor pumpkin growth in real time, detecting potential issues early on, allowing for prompt intervention.
- Prognostication models can be constructed to forecast future yields, helping farmers in implementing informed choices about input allocation.
- AI can also be employed to optimize irrigation, fertilization, and pest control methods, leading to more sustainable farming systems.
By embracing AI algorithms, pumpkin farmers can unlock new levels of effectiveness, finally producing higher profits and a more robust pumpkin patch.
